Leadership refers to the ability to guide, inspire, and influence individuals or groups towards a common goal. It involves taking charge, making decisions, and motivating others to achieve objectives. Leadership can be found in various contexts, such as business, politics, sports, and community organizations. Effective leadership typically involves qualities such as vision, communication, integrity, empathy, and the ability to inspire and empower others.

3. THERE ARE DIFFERENT LEADERSHIP STYLES, INCLUDING:
Autocratic Leadership: In this style, the leader makes decisions
without much input from others and maintains strict control over
the group.
Democratic Leadership: This style involves involving team
members in decision-making processes, encouraging participation,
and valuing diverse perspectives.

Transformational Leadership: Transformational leaders inspire and
motivate their followers to achieve higher levels of performance. They
often have a clear vision, communicate effectively, and empower others.
Servant Leadership: Servant leaders prioritize the needs of their team
members and work towards their development and well-being.
Laissez-faire Leadership: This style involves minimal interference from
the leader, allowing individuals or teams to have a high degree of
autonomy and responsibility.

It's important to note that effective leadership is not limited to one
specific style. Different situations may require different leadership
approaches. Successful leaders often adapt their style to suit the needs
of the situation and the individuals they are leading.
Leadership skills can be developed through experience, training, and
self-reflection. Many leaders continuously work on improving their
abilities by learning from their successes and failures, seeking
feedback, and acquiring new knowledge and perspectives.
